Output 56253317297b040d7c74b95cf59062cce95155d5875a87c03e4f259ef82e7389:4

value
22389208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9838a173e9f90806b48840692ca4430f13b3b491 OP_EQUAL
address
MMn2nMe9weibPUJD77n7Nu8hPFqtDeVZuc
transaction
56253317297b040d7c74b95cf59062cce95155d5875a87c03e4f259ef82e7389
spent
true